CHICAGO – The Illinois Department of Public Health announced that a Kane and McHenry County resident has tested positive for coronavirus disease. The cases include a Kane County woman in her 60s and a McHenry County teen, neither of whom had a history of travel to an affected area and no connection to a known case of COVID-19. Public health officials are identifying and contacting all close contacts. Currently, there are 19 individuals in Illinois who have tested positive for COVID-19.
